The common preflop odds chart displays probabilities for being dealt specific starting hands preflop in Texas Holdem. It assumes using a 52-card deck. Your first hole card can be one of 52 cards and the other one may be one of 51 (52-1) cards. This makes a total of 1,326 starting hand combinations (52x51/2).Poker Odds Charts. This poker news article examines the poker odds calculator and how it works.A poker probability, or an odds calculator, is a tool designed to calculate the percentage probability of a hand in a round. It takes information like the player’s hole cards, the community cards, and possibly that of other players as input, and the output it provides is the chance you have of winning the game. Like a gambling winnings tax calculator, this tool helps you make more informed decisions. During a game, it shows you the poker odds various hands have.In recent casino news, poker probability calculators have become popular for online games, assisting with real-time decision-making. These tools analyze odds and expected value, offering an advantage. However, experienced players often caution against over-reliance, advocating mastering poker math independentlyHow Does A Poker Probability Odds Calculator Work?A poker hand odds calculator uses algorithms with pre-defined probabilities to estimate your chances of winning with a poker hand. The tool analyzes the community cards, your hand, and potential opponents’ hands, calculating odds and offering recommendations. More information about poker odds Pot Odds: Learning how to calculate pot odds is your mathematical solution to making the decision on whether to call or fold your hand. Playing pot odds means knowing what your chances of pulling the card you need to make your hand a winner. Successful Betting Using Pot Odds: You will find many strategy articles giving you advice on how to use Pot Odds to decide whether to stay in a pot or to fold. It is also a good idea to use Pot Odds to decide how much to bet in pot-limit and no-limit games. Wizard Recommends $200 deposit bonus US/AU Players Welcome Poker, Sportsbook and Casino Mobile and Desktop Last updated: Oct 16, 2023 On this page IntroductionQ Poker is a game I noticed at the Lisboa in Macau in August 2007. It is very similar to Three Card Poker. The first difference is that instead of having the choice to raise or fold, the player may surrender or call. In both games the player will win half his total bet if the dealer does not qualify, in this case half the Ante bet. The dealer must qualify, and the player must beat the dealer, to be paid premium odds for a straight or higher. The Pairplus bet is exactly the same in both games. The strategy is also exactly the same.RulesPlayer makes an Ante and/or Pairplus bet.The dealer gives each player three cards and himself three cards. The player may examine his own cards. The dealer's cards are dealt face down.If the player made the Ante bet, then he may surrender his hand for half the Ante bet. The dealer will turn over his cards.The dealer needs a queen high or better to qualify. If the dealer does not qualify, then the player's Ante bet will pay 1 to 2 (win of half the bet amount).If the dealer qualifies, then the player's hand will be compared to the dealer's hand, and the higher hand wins.
